Ownership and Operational Transparency

Legitimate platforms disclose founding teams, company registration details, and clear contact methods beyond anonymous email addresses. This doesn’t necessarily mean full KYC-style identification, but established operators maintain public reputations they can’t simply abandon without consequences. Anonymous teams aren’t automatic disqualifiers – many crypto projects operate pseudonymously successfully – but they increase risk since accountability mechanisms disappear if problems arise. Platforms listing physical business addresses, registered company numbers, or established social media presence with years of post history provide more accountability than sites appearing suddenly with no traceable background. Cross-referencing team members against blockchain industry databases like LinkedIn or crypto project directories reveals whether operators have legitimate experience or fabricated credentials.

Smart Contract Architecture and Security Practices

  • Published and verified contract source code on Etherscan, allowing public inspection of platform logic
  • Recent security audits from recognised firms (CertiK, Trail of Bits, Quantstamp) with findings addressed rather than ignored
  • Multi-signature wallet implementation requiring multiple approvals for large fund movements
  • Bug bounty programs incentivise security researchers to discover vulnerabilities before malicious actors exploit them
  • Regular updates addressing emerging security concerns rather than stagnant code bases unchanged for months

Liquidity Depth and Reserve Proof

Value platforms maintain sufficient liquidity to handle normal winning sessions without processing delays or payment issues. Reserve proof systems allow players to verify platforms hold claimed amounts through cryptographic attestation, similar to how exchanges prove solvency. This involves platforms signing messages with wallet addresses holding user funds, proving control without revealing individual balances. Platforms refusing to provide reserve proof or showing reserves significantly below estimated player deposits raise serious concerns about fractional reserve operations that could fail during high withdrawal periods. Testing withdrawal speed with progressively larger amounts reveals actual liquidity – platforms processing 1 ETH instantly, but delaying 10 ETH requests lack adequate reserves for serious operation.

Market Competitiveness and Margin Analysis

Comparing odds across multiple platforms for identical events reveals which operators offer genuine value versus inflated margins. Quality platforms maintain 2-4% margins on major markets, competitive with traditional sportsbooks, while offering cryptocurrency benefits. Platforms consistently showing 6-8%+ margins either lack the sophistication to compile competitive lines or intentionally price unfavorably, hoping users won’t comparison shop. This becomes especially apparent on lower-tier events where casual platforms inflate margins dramatically, sometimes reaching 15-20% on niche markets with limited attention. Using odds comparison tools or manually checking 5-10 events across platforms quickly identifies whether a site provides fair pricing or extracts excessive house edge.

Communication Patterns and Community Engagement

Active platforms maintain social media presence, respond to user questions publicly, and address concerns transparently rather than deleting criticism. Official channels should show regular updates about platform developments, maintenance schedules, and resolved issues rather than purely promotional content. Community sentiment across neutral forums like Reddit or crypto-focused discussion boards reveals operational quality better than curated testimonials on platform websites. Patterns of unresolved withdrawal complaints, disappeared support staff, or sudden rule changes indicate operational problems worth avoiding. Conversely, platforms with years of positive community feedback and resolved dispute histories demonstrate commitment to fair operation.
